PSG are set to welcome Auxerre to the Parc des Princes this Saturday as they aim to recover from their opening Ligue 1 defeat against Marseille.
The reigning champions sit second in Ligue 1 after five matches, level on points with Monaco, Lyon, and Strasbourg, but placed second due to goal difference. Auxerre, meanwhile, find themselves in tenth position with six points from their opening five fixtures.
PSG vs Auxerre – Predicted lineup and team news
PSG Team News
Luis Enrique is still dealing with a string of injury troubles. Star forward Ousmane Dembélé is sidelined for around six weeks following a severe hamstring injury sustained while on duty with the French national team. The Ballon d’Or winner will be absent for this Ligue 1 clash as well as the upcoming crucial Champions League encounter with Barcelona on October 1.
Meanwhile, Bradley Barcola and João Neves are on the mend from minor muscle strains. Midfielder Désiré Doué remains out with a calf injury and was expected to be sidelined for roughly a month, though there is a slight possibility he could make an appearance against Barcelona.
PSG Predicted Lineup
PSG Predicted XI: Chevalier; Hakimi, Zabarnyi, Beraldo, Hernandez; Zaire-Emery, Vitinha, Ruiz, Mendes; Ramos, Kvaratskhelia.
When is PSG vs Auxerre?
27th September Saturday at 8:05pm BST.
How to Watch PSG vs Auxerre?
For supporters in the UK, the match will be broadcast live on Amazon Prime Video as well as through the Ligue 1 Pass streaming service.
